Wings v. Bruins 11/3/09

Detroit goal (1-0) 14:21 in 1st period; PPG Zetterberg from Datsyuk:
Right off the faceoff, the puck trickles ahead and into the slot area. Zetterberg's right there and rips a shot off. This play developed so quickly the netminder barely had time to react. Really nice blink-or-you'll-miss-it play.

Detroit goal (2-0) 17:43 in 1st period; Holmstrom from Datsyuk & Bertuzzi:
This might be the best Wings goal I've seen yet this year. Bertuzzi throws the puck down the ice. Datsyuk knocks the pass out of the air, gets it on his stick, passes it behind himself, and finds Holmstrom behind him. How he knew Homer was there I really don't know, because it doesn't look like he ever turns his head to check.
